Miami gets the go-ahead, Hamilton wants to help

Formula 1 could be racing in Miami as early as October 2019 after receiving unanimously approved by the city's commission. Earlier this week the City of Miami Commissioners and the Economic Development and Tourism Committee voted on a proposal to host a Formula 1 grand prix on the city's streets. F1 managing director Sean Bratches said: 'With the unanimous votes at both the City of Miami and Miami-Dade County’s Economic Development and Tourism Committee, we are very pleased to have received preliminary approval towards bringing a Formula 1 Grand Prix to Miami.
